£10 million investment for Port of Nigg redevelopment
Up to £10 million will be invested in the redevelopment of the Port of Nigg to create a new quayside for offshore wind farm components. This funding is part of a larger Scottish government commitment of £500 million for the Inverness and Cromarty Firth Green Freeport. The UK government recently granted Nigg its own customs arrangements, simplifying paperwork and reducing costs for imported engineering equipment. This is the first site in the freeport to receive this designation. The Inverness and Cromarty Firth Green Freeport aims to create over 10,000 jobs and attract more than £3 billion in investment. It offers tax incentives and commitments to net zero targets and fair work practices.
